ESC $ nL nH
[Name] Set absolute print position
[Format] ASCII ESC $ n
L nH
Hex 1B 24 nL nH
Decimal 27 36 nL nH
[Range] 0≤nL≤255
0≤nH≤255
[Description] Sets the distance from the beginning of the line to the position at which subsequent characters
are to be printed.
[Details] ·The distance from the beginning of the line to the print position is
[(n
L + nH x 256) x (vertical or horizontal motion unit)] inches.
·Settings outside the specified printable area are ignored.
·The horizontal and vertical motion units are specified by “GS P”.
·The GS P command can change the horizontal (and vertical) motion unit.
However, the value cannot be less than the minimum horizontal movement amount, and it
must be in even units of the minimum horizontal movement amount. In standard mode, the
horizontal motion unit is used.
·In page mode, the horizontal or vertical motion unit differs depending on the starting position of
the printable area as follows :
1. When the starting position is set to the upper left or lower right of the printable area using
ESC T, the horizontal motion unit (x) is used.
2. When the starting position is set to the upper right or lower left of the printable area using
ESC T, the vertical motion unit (y) is used.
[Reference] ESC \, GS $, GS \, GS P
ESC % n
[Name] Select/cancel user-defined character set
[Format] ASCII ESC % n
Hex 1B 25 n
Decimal 27 37 n
[Range] 0≤n ≤255
[Description] Selects or cancels the user-defined character set
·When the LSB of n is 0, the user-defined character set is canceled.
·When the LSB of n is 1, the user-defined character set is selected.
[Details] ·When the user-defined character set is canceled, the internal character
set is automatically selected.
·n is available only for the least significant bit.
[Default] n = 0
[Reference] ESC &, ESC ?
